Vernon Kay and Tess Daly reportedly marked the end of their 25-year marriage in an unexpectedly calm and emotional way — by sharing a bottle of champagne together inside their Buckinghamshire mansion after announcing their separation.
The beloved TV couple stunned fans on Friday when they confirmed they were splitting after more than two decades together. Despite the heartbreaking news, insiders insist there has been “no big fallout” between the pair, who are determined to stay close friends and supportive parents to daughters Phoebe, 21, and Amber, 16.

According to reports, Vernon and Tess uploaded their joint Instagram statement before quietly raising a glass to each other and to “their futures” inside the home they still share together. A source claimed the pair wanted to “keep things classy” as they move into the next chapter of their lives.
The insider explained: “After they released the statement, Vernon and Tess took a moment to toast each other and their futures. They only want the best for each other and their family.”
Friends close to the couple say the split was not caused by a dramatic betrayal or explosive argument, but rather years of slowly drifting apart. “They’ve basically been living separate lives,” one source revealed, adding that the pair no longer shared the same hobbies or interests and eventually realised they would be happier apart.

Even so, the separation is said to be incredibly amicable. The two stars are reportedly still living together for now at their mansion in Beaconsfield while they work through the next stage of their lives. Their daughters were also said to be fully involved in conversations about the split.
In their emotional public statement, the pair wrote: “After much consideration, and with a deep sense of care and respect for one another, we have made the decision to separate amicably.”
They continued: “This has not been an easy choice, but it comes from a place of mutual understanding and a shared desire of what is best for both of us.”
The couple also firmly denied that any third party was involved in the breakdown of the marriage and asked for privacy during the difficult time.
Vernon and Tess first met in 2001 while working together on Top Of The Pops@Play. Vernon later admitted he was instantly attracted to Tess because of her independence, recalling: “She spotted me in a crowd and we had a laugh.”

The pair became one of British television’s most adored couples, marrying in 2003 and building a glamorous showbiz life together reportedly worth around £10million.
However, their relationship famously faced turmoil in 2010 when Vernon admitted to sending flirty messages to glamour model Rhian Sugden. At the time, Vernon publicly confessed: “I’ve let down my wife Tess. I’m an idiot. I’ve been stupid and daft but I’m not a sex pest.”
Tess eventually forgave him and the couple continued to present a united front for years afterward, with many fans believing they had survived the scandal for good.
Their split now comes just months after Tess stepped down from Strictly Come Dancing following more than two decades fronting the BBC juggernaut.
Friends say both Vernon and Tess are now looking ahead positively despite the sadness surrounding the end of their marriage. One insider insisted: “They are actually really, really happy now.”
